Different Types or Models of the Pipettes

Kalstein offers a diverse range of pipettes to cater to different laboratory needs. From single-channel to multi-channel models, each type is tailored to meet specific experimental requirements. The single-channel pipettes are ideal for tasks that require precise and accurate liquid handling, while the multi-channel pipettes are perfect for high-throughput tasks, such as those found in ELISA or PCR plate filling.

Additionally, Kalstein provides both manual and electronic pipettes. The manual pipettes are straightforward and reliable, suitable for labs that need cost-effective yet precise tools. On the other hand, the electronic pipettes offer advanced features like adjustable speeds and memory settings, providing an extra layer of convenience for complex or repetitive tasks. How often should Kalstein pipettes be calibrated?

Regular calibration is suggested, typically every six months, to maintain precision and accuracy, but this can vary depending on usage frequency.

Can electronic models be used without a power source?

Electronic pipettes require a power source to access advanced features, but they often come with rechargeable battery options for mobility.
